Our May 2013 New Music Releases rundown finds a lot of  legends returning to the shelves.

First off, we're going to see a new album from CCR front man John Fogerty, who's joined by an all-star roster that includes Foo Fighters, Kid Rock and Miranda Lambert, Keith Urban and Bob Seger to pay tribute to  -- er, himself on a new project.

Timeless rocker Rod Stewart will not only be the subject of a 4-CD box set, he will also release his first album of new rock material in years, which he has described as "just a good, old-fashioned Rod Stewart album [with] a lot of mandolin and acoustic [guitar] and fiddles and good storytelling, I believe, too.” Fans have already heard three songs; 'She Makes Me Happy,' 'Finest Woman' and 'It's Over.'

We'll also see archival material from Bob Dylan, Lynyrd Skynyrd and Paul McCartney in May, and celebrate the music of the Moody Blues with a pair of live DVDs that document two very different eras of their career. And if that's not enough to get your May rockin', the critically acclaimed Rolling Stones documentary 'Crossfire Hurricane' will see a home release.
